小学学编程学什么内容
-
小学学编程主要学习以下内容:
-
程序设计思维:编程是一种解决问题的思维方式,小学学编程首先需要培养学生的程序设计思维。这包括培养逻辑思维能力、分析问题和设计解决方案的能力,以及培养学生的创新和合作精神。
-
基础编程语言:小学生可以学习一些简单易懂的编程语言,如Scratch、Python等。通过这些编程语言,学生可以学习如何使用代码来创建动画、游戏等,并通过编程项目锻炼编程能力。
-
算法和数据结构:学习编程需要了解一些基本的算法和数据结构。小学生可以学习一些简单的算法和数据结构,如顺序查找、二分查找、栈、队列等,通过理解和应用这些概念,提升编程能力。
-
网页设计和开发:随着互联网的发展,学习网页设计和开发对于小学生也是很有帮助的。学生可以学习一些基本的HTML、CSS和JavaScript知识,创建简单的网页,并且学习如何将网页发布到互联网上。
-
创意编程项目:编程能够培养学生的创造力和创新精神,小学生可以通过编写编程代码和开发创意项目来锻炼自己的创造力和实践能力。例如,学生可以编写一个简单的聊天机器人、多媒体播放器等项目。
总而言之,小学学编程主要是培养学生的程序设计思维和创新能力,并通过学习编程语言、算法和数据结构以及开发创意项目来提升学生的编程能力。这将为他们未来的学习和工作奠定良好的基础。
1年前 -
-
小学学编程主要学习以下内容:
-
算法思维:编程是一种解决问题的方法。学习编程首先要培养学生的算法思维,让他们能够分析问题、设计解决方案,并将其转化为编程语言。
-
编程语言:小学生学编程一般从简单易学的编程语言开始,如Scratch、Python等。这些编程语言具有直观的可视化编程界面,帮助学生理解和实践算法思维的基本概念和逻辑。
-
基本编程概念:小学生通过学习编程可以掌握一些基本的编程概念,如变量、循环、条件判断等。这些概念是编程的基础,对于学生日后的编程学习和应用都非常重要。
-
创意编程:小学生学编程不仅仅是为了学习编程技术,更重要的是培养他们的创造力和创新思维。通过编程,学生可以自己设计和制作各种小游戏、动画等创意作品,培养他们的创造力和解决问题的能力。
-
团队合作:在学习编程的过程中,小学生还可以通过分组合作的方式完成一些项目,培养他们的团队合作精神和沟通能力。通过共同完成一个编程项目,学生可以学会与他人合作、分享和交流自己的想法,培养团队合作意识和技能。
小学学编程不仅可以让学生掌握一些基本的编程知识和技能,还可以培养学生的创造力、逻辑思维和解决问题的能力。这些能力对于学生未来的学习和生活都有着重要的影响。因此,编程教育已经成为越来越多小学教育的一部分。
1年前 -
-
小学阶段的编程教育主要以培养学生的逻辑思维能力、问题解决能力和创新精神为目标。以下是小学学编程的具体内容:
-
了解计算机基础知识:学生需要了解计算机的基本组成、工作原理和常见的软硬件设备。
-
认识编程语言:小学阶段的编程教育通常采用基于图形化编程语言的方式,如Scratch、Blockly等。这些编程语言使用图形模块代替传统的编程语法,能够让学生更加直观地理解编程概念和逻辑结构。
-
学习编程思维:编程思维是指通过编程的方式解决实际问题的思考方式。学生需要学习如何将问题分解为更小的子问题、进行逻辑推理和分析,并设计出合适的算法来解决问题。
-
简单的编程项目:学生可以通过完成一些简单的编程项目来巩固所学知识和技能,如制作游戏、动画、故事等。这些项目既可以培养学生的创造力,又可以提高他们的问题解决能力和动手能力。
-
培养合作精神:编程教育可以通过团队合作的方式进行,让学生学会与他人合作、协调和沟通,培养团队合作精神。
-
基础算法和数据结构:小学阶段可以初步学习一些基础的算法和数据结构,如顺序、选择、循环结构,以及数组和列表等,为进一步学习高级算法打下基础。
-
探索物联网和机器人编程:小学生可以通过编程来探索物联网和机器人技术,学习如何利用编程控制物体和设备的运动和行为。
-
培养创新意识:编程教育可以培养学生的创新意识和创造力,鼓励他们设计和开发自己的项目和应用,形成独立思考和解决问题的能力。
通过以上内容的学习,小学生可以初步掌握编程的基本原理和方法,培养逻辑思维能力和创新精神,为进一步学习和发展打下坚实的基础。
1年前 -